Subject: Profile store sharding — review needed

Splitting the Moonvale user-profile store into 16 shards by account hash. Migration is dual-write with a backfill job; reads flip per-shard behind a flag. Reviewer: focus on the rebalance logic in shardmap.go — that's the risky part. Everything else is plumbing. Target merge Thursday. Candidate build token for the canary follows.

build token for kagaf-hahof: htk14_9d3d4d26d7d8de

Subject: Key rotation — Tidewatch widget backend

Hi folks, quick heads-up for whoever's on call this week: we rotated the service key the Tidewatch tide-table widget uses to pull predictions from the Moonpull forecast service. The old key dies Friday at noon. If the widget starts showing stale tables, swap in the new key and redeploy. Here's the replacement key for the on-call config.

service key, kawig-hahaf: zpat4_JspY

## Authentication

Websocket compression on Ferngate is per-connection. permessage-deflate saves ~60% bandwidth on chatty channels but costs CPU and memory per socket; above ~20k connections it's a net loss. Compression negotiation happens before auth, so malformed extension headers get rejected early. Auth itself runs against the Hollowmere token service on handshake completion. Maintainers testing locally should disable compression to isolate auth failures. The staging handshake endpoint accepts the internal service key shown here.

API key for tagef-fafop: vxb2-ta

**Loyalty Programme Overhaul — Managers Only**

The Brightmere Rewards scheme will be replaced by a tiered points model across all branches in the coming two quarters. Branch managers should review redemption patterns carefully before the Ashvale pilot concludes and avoid discussing timelines with frontline staff. Further strategic detail is set out below.

internal memo for kawip-hadug: Headcount on the Wenwyn team goes from 7 to 140 by the end of January. Gross margin on Wenwyn came in at 20 percent against a plan of 15 percent.

Q2 Planning Note — Insurance Renewal

Branch managers: the group policy with Ardent Mutual renews in eight weeks. Premiums expected up 9%; property valuations due back by month-end. Submit updated asset registers and incident logs promptly. Late submissions risk coverage gaps. Broker meetings are scheduled for the first week of the quarter. One confidential item follows below.

management briefing: Project Ulavan slips by two quarters because of the staffing delay.